French New Novel synopsis
The most important development in recent French novels is the new Roman novel, The New Novel, which was first observed in the mid-1950s and later became influential throughout the world. Characterized by the disregard of chronology, the emergence of objects and space, the replacement of the pattern of conspiracy, the non-traditional treatment of dialogue, and a new approach to nature, has provoked, and sometimes antagonistic, critics and public readers in rejecting the traditional Platzian novel. In this introduction to the American public, Laurent Le Saag discusses the aims and aspirations of the "new" novelists in France and highlights their attachment to Anglo-American literary theory and German philosophy.
Professor George May of Yale University, "a complex literary phenomenon in a coherent and very understandable form." Translated samples of the new writing were included, some of which first appeared in English. Biographical and bibliographic material for the works and criticism of each author were compiled..
